Beyond the Kingdoms[]
Glinda is mentioned by Alex in Beyond the Kingdoms, when she and her friends land in the Land of Oz. They are briefly scared that they may have accidentally killed her by dropping the barn on her, but it turns out the Tin Woodman was under it (and relatively unharmed).[1]
Behind the Scenes[]
- Glinda was mentioned by Chris Colfer as a possible character for following installments and that he originally planned to have her and Red Riding Hood have a quarrel.[2]
